Posted: Sat Mar 01, 2003 12:54 am Post subject: [Asterisk-Dev] zapata.conf group bug?
Group is not for ringing all the channels at the same time.
When you group some channels then asterisk chooses
the first idle channel to ring/dial out.
If you want to ring some channels at the same time then
you have to do this like that:
exten => s,1,Dial,Zap/21&Zap/23&Zap/24

Your group will apply to any channels following the definition. If you
want a channel to be a member of more than one group you should do
group=1,2 and so on.
Quote:
The result of this configuration is that if I do a Dial,Zap/g1, then
only channel 21 rings, not 21, 23, and 24.
Of course, because it's the first available channel. Dialing a group does
not ring all interfaces, just the first available one.
